Output 93f5d683318b701bf38f62cb776c046277e35e87f126c135d8c2d0c41423c1b7:1

value
24876760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9b93900b8a7078d9c2cb89256c2ec09684b95bea OP_EQUALVERIFY OP_CHECKSIG
address
LZQZmnGEfmKMuEjacnqPR4Dq9emZfXBjNm
transaction
93f5d683318b701bf38f62cb776c046277e35e87f126c135d8c2d0c41423c1b7
spent
true